Hi as part of your local town centre beat team we would like to hear your feedback on what you think of policing in the area. the residents voice survey takes just a couple of minutes to complete and all responses come straight to the town centre team.
Past survey replies involve the drinkers/ rough sleepers causing issues in town, we have since worked closely with partner agencies to reduce the amount of town centre street drinkers, we have removed street furniture which was used by the groups, we have worked with them to try and support them and have when needed took action against the individuals for anti social behaviour. The incidents of ASB involving these groups in town centre has reduced dramatically.
Other issues highlighted involve theft of pedal cycles, we have carried out bike marking at all our vpx events and have had extra days of marking, we also with help from Warrington BID/Safer streets funding gave out 100 D-Locks to prevent thefts unfortunately bike thefts are still occurring so we do ask people to make sure bikes are secure if in town, new cycle station at the bus interchange and Warrington cycle hub are both excellent sites.
finally lots of complaints regarding food delivery riders in town we have done lots of work with traffic and immigration to check legality of electric bikes being used and legality of people working, which is still ongoing.
Warrington town centre does benefit from Project Servator deployments which does help deter and reduce crime in the town, again working with security and Warrington CCTV team who do an amazing job for us.
